Sushi Experience №11

The food was okay, some of it was good, others were a miss. Starting with the misses, the age tofu was supposed to be served with tempura sauce however this wasn't really the case. At best it was served with a light beef broth rather than a traditional tempura sauce. And by light I do mean quite light, you couldn't taste it at all over the flavor of the tofu. If you want your tofu crispy do not get this dish as the tofu is sitting in the broth when it's served to you, rendering the coating a bit soggy.

The next miss comes in the form of the Unagi Don. This dish costs about $24 however you get maybe 8-10 slices of Unagi (aka eel) arranged in a flower pattern of sorts. For this price this dish is a rip off and not worth the cost. Most unagi dons come with the rice completely covered in a layer of unagi which was not the case here. Even eating the rice generously with each bite of unagi I was still left with at least half a bowl of rice with nothing to eat it with. On top of this, you don't even get a soup to go with it at this price point which is disappointing. In fact, there were no sides provided with the dish. For this same price you could go to the Santa Fe Asian Market and buy an whole eel. At least the eel was moist and heated nicely so there was that.

Now for the good stuff, getting the miso soup was actually quite pleasant. The soup itself had lots of flavor and was really nice on a cool day. My partner got the Tofu Dolsotbop, which she thoroughly enjoyed. The toppings were a plenty and they gave her the option to add the egg in when they brought it tableside. However she did have to ask for the gochujang to be brought out as she was never asked if she wanted it.

As this was our first time there, we haven't had the opportunity to try other menu options however first impressions are that it's over priced. If I were on a date night with my partner at the railyard and we were in the mood for this type of cuisine I might be willing to give it a second chance.

Sushi Experience №100

The service was good, we were well attended, the food was rather bad. We ordered their signature Bento dish which comes with protein (meat or tofu), tempura, a salad, sushi rolls, pickles, vegetable and rice. The teriyaki chicken was barely warm and quite rubbery, definitely not fresh at all, but rather precooked, quickly warmed in a microwave and smothered with the sauce. The tempura was very greasy and it fell off the shrimp and vegetables, the inside was cold. I am of the impression that the tempura was already fried previously, stored (perhaps from the day before ?) and then simply refried in an attempt to heat it again. Hence it was so greasy, the contents cool and rubbery and the batter simply falling off. The pickles were shriveled and unappealing. The only two items that were really acceptable was the salad and the rice. We also ordered sushi as appetizers, which were rather expensive and not that good. To sum it up, something in all this fare was not becoming, for within a couple of hours I got stomach issues. Maybe we had our dinner too early (around 5pm) and that was all available at the time. What raised my suspicions early on was the fact that the food was served rather too quickly after having been seated.
The price rating on google giving $$ seems to be rather misleading, for I would definitely mark this as a $$$ and $$$$ place.
